According to a recent report from the BBC, activists who were part of a Gaza flotilla have alleged that they were subjected to abuse while being held by Israeli forces. The detainees said they were slapped, hit, humiliated, and even subjected to sexual violence. However, Israel’s prison service has stated that these allegations are false. The flotilla was attempting to breach the blockade of Gaza, an operation that has drawn international scrutiny in the past. The number of detainees and the exact timeframe of the alleged incidents were not specified in the source. The Israeli authorities have not released additional details, and the prison service’s denial underscores a contentious dispute over the treatment of the activists.

This development may have implications for Israeli defense and security companies that operate globally. Firms such as Elbit Systems or Israel Aerospace Industries could face heightened attention from human rights organizations and investors focusing on ethical practices. The allegations might also influence diplomatic relations, potentially affecting trade agreements or foreign investment flows into Israel. The Israeli shekel could experience volatility if the story gains sustained traction in international media. However, without independent verification or an official investigation, market impact would likely be limited to sentiment-driven fluctuations. The denial by Israeli authorities suggests the situation remains contested, which could lead to a period of uncertainty for stakeholders.
